实现centos系统的自动化安装部署

1.使用kickstart实现半自动化安装centos系统

 

实现过程

[root@centos8 ~]#mkdir –pv /data/myiso
[root@centos8 ~]#cp -r /mnt/isolinux/ /data/myiso/
[root@centos8 ~]#tree /data/myiso/
/data/myiso/
└── isolinux
├── boot.cat
  ├── boot.msg
  ├── grub.conf
  ├── initrd.img
  ├── isolinux.bin
  ├── isolinux.cfg
  ├── ldlinux.c32
  ├── libcom32.c32
  ├── libutil.c32
  ├── memtest
  ├── splash.png
  ├── TRANS.TBL
  ├── vesamenu.c32
  └── vmlinuz
1 directory, 14 files
[root@centos8 ~]#vim /data/myiso/isolinux/isolinux.cfg
#方法1:应答方件放在ISO文件里
label linux
menu label ^Auto Install CentOS Linux 8
kernel vmlinuz
 initrd=initrd.img text ks=cdrom:/myks.cfg
#方法2:应答方件放在http服务器上
label linux
menu label ^Auto Install CentOS Linux 8
kernel vmlinuz
append initrd=initrd.img quiet ks=http://10.0.0.8/ksdir/centos8.cfg
label rescue
menu label ^Rescue a CentOS Linux system
kernel vmlinuz
append initrd=initrd.img inst.repo=http://10.0.0.8/centos/8 rescue quiet
label local
menu default
menu label Boot from ^local drive
localboot 0xffff
[root@centos8 ~]#cp /root/myks.cfg /data/myiso/
[root@centos8 ~]#dnf -y install mkisofs
[root@centos8 ~]#mkisofs -R -J -T -v --no-emul-boot --boot-load-size 4 --boot
info-table -V "CentOS 8.0 x86_64 boot" -b isolinux/isolinux.bin -c
isolinux/boot.cat -o /root/boot.iso /data/myiso/
注意:以上相对路径都是相对于光盘的根,和工作目录无关

2.实现pxe自动化安装centos系统

pxe自动化安装流程

1. Client向PXE Server上的DHCP发送IP地址请求消息,DHCP检测Client是否合法(主要是检测Client的网卡MAC地址),如果合法则返回Client的IP地址,同时将启动文件pxelinux.0的所在TFTP服务器地址信息一并传送给Client
2. Client向TFTP服务器发送获取pxelinux.0请求消息,TFTP服务器接收到消息之后,向Client发送pxelinux.0大小信息,试探Client是否满意,当TFTP收到Client发回的同意大小信息之后,正式向Client发送pxelinux.0
3. Client执行接收到的pxelinux.0文件,并利用此文件启动
4. Client向TFTP 服务器发送请求针对本机的配置信息文件(在TFTP 服务器的pxelinux.cfg目录下),TFTP服务器将启动菜单配置文件发回Client,继而Client根据启动菜单配置文件执行后续操作
5. Client根据启动菜单配置文件里的信息,向TFTP发送Linux内核和initrd文件请求信息,TFTP接收到消息之后将内核和initrd文件发送给Client
6. Client向TFTP发送根文件请求信息,TFTP接收到消息之后返回Linux根文件系统
7. Client启动Linux内核,加载相关的内核参数
8. Client通过内核参数下载kickstart文件,并根据kickstart文件里的安装信息,下载安装源文件进行自动化安装

实现在cenots8上自动化安装centos6,7,8

1.安装前准备

#关闭防火墙和selinux,DHCP服务器静态IP
#网络要求:关闭vmware软件中的DHCP服务,基于NAT模式
#注意:centos7,8使用1G内存会显示空间不足,建议2G

2.安装相关包并启动

#下载安装dhcp,httpd,tftp服务
[root@centos8 ~]# yum -y install dhcp-server httpd tftp-server syslinux-nonlinux
#启动服务
[root@centos8 ~]# systemctl enable --now dhcpd tftp httpd
Created symlink /etc/systemd/system/multi-user.target.wants/dhcpd.service → /usr/lib/systemd/system/dhcpd.service.
Created symlink /etc/systemd/system/sockets.target.wants/tftp.socket → /usr/lib/systemd/system/tftp.socket.
Created symlink /etc/systemd/system/multi-user.target.wants/httpd.service → /usr/lib/systemd/system/httpd.service.
Job for dhcpd.service failed because the control process exited with error code.
See "systemctl status dhcpd.service" and "journalctl -xe" for details.
#其中dhcp服务是启动不了的,原因是配置文件无内容,需要在修改配置文件后才可启动

3.配置dhcp服务

#写dhcp服务配置文件,可通过配置文件范例进行修改
[root@centos8 ~]# cp /usr/share/doc/dhcp-server/dhcpd.conf.example /etc/dhcp/dhcpd.conf
cp: overwrite '/etc/dhcp/dhcpd.conf'? yes #将范例配置文件拷贝当配置文件路径,覆盖原内容
#将拷贝的配置文件内容进行部分修改即可
[root@centos8 ~]# cat /etc/dhcp/dhcpd.conf
#
# DHCP Server Configuration file.
# see /usr/share/doc/dhcp-server/dhcpd.conf.example
# see dhcpd.conf(5) man page
#
#
option domain-name "example.com";
option domain-name-servers 180.76.76.76,223.6.6.6; #配置DNS地址
default-lease-time 600; #默认地址租期
max-lease-time 7200; #最大租期,无特殊要求给默认租期,有要求给最大租期
log-facility local7;
subnet 10.0.0.0 netmask 255.255.255.0 { #指定网段分配地址池
range 10.0.0.100 10.0.0.200; #分配地址范围
option routers 10.0.0.2; #指定网关
next-server 10.0.0.8; #指定tftp服务器地址,该实验tftp与dhcp服务都在8主机实现,因此只想8IP
filename "pxelinux.0"; #bootloader启动文件的名称
}
#将dhcp服务开启
[root@centos8 ~]# systemctl start dhcpd
[root@centos8 ~]# systemctl status dhcpd
● dhcpd.service - DHCPv4 Server Daemon
Loaded: loaded (/usr/lib/systemd/system/dhcpd.service; enabled; vendor preset: disabled)
Active: active (running) since Thu 2020-09-10 16:42:29 CST; 1min 17s ago

4.准备yum源和相关目录

#在服务器的http服务上创建6,7,8对应的文件夹
[root@centos8 ~]# mkdir -pv /var/www/html/centos/{6,7,8}/os/x86_64/
mkdir: created directory '/var/www/html/centos'
mkdir: created directory '/var/www/html/centos/6'
mkdir: created directory '/var/www/html/centos/6/os'
mkdir: created directory '/var/www/html/centos/6/os/x86_64/'
mkdir: created directory '/var/www/html/centos/7'
mkdir: created directory '/var/www/html/centos/7/os'
mkdir: created directory '/var/www/html/centos/7/os/x86_64/'
mkdir: created directory '/var/www/html/centos/8'
mkdir: created directory '/var/www/html/centos/8/os'
mkdir: created directory '/var/www/html/centos/8/os/x86_64/'
#在服务器上添加光驱,分别添加光驱挂载光盘为6,7,8
[root@centos8 ~]# lsblk
NAME MAJ:MIN RM SIZE RO TYPE MOUNTPOINT
sda 8:0 0 200G 0 disk
├─sda1 8:1 0 1G 0 part /boot
├─sda2 8:2 0 100G 0 part /
├─sda3 8:3 0 2G 0 part [SWAP]
├─sda4 8:4 0 1K 0 part
└─sda5 8:5 0 50G 0 part /data
sr0 11:0 1 7G 0 rom #通过大小查看为8光盘
sr1 11:1 1 10.3G 0 rom #7光盘
sr2 11:2 1 3.7G 0 rom #6光盘
#添加光驱之后识别不了执行echo --- > /sys/class/scsi_host/host0/scan进行扫描添加光驱,添加光驱之后需要分清三个光盘分别是哪个系统版本的光盘
#分别将挂光盘进行挂载在对应的文件夹,实现提供6,7,8的yum源
[root@centos8 ~]# mount /dev/sr0 /var/www/html/centos/8/os/x86_64/
mount: /var/www/html/centos/8/os/x86_64: WARNING: device write-protected, mounted read-only.
[root@centos8 ~]# mount /dev/sr1 /var/www/html/centos/7/os/x86_64/
mount: /var/www/html/centos/7/os/x86_64: WARNING: device write-protected, mounted read-only.
[root@centos8 ~]# mount /dev/sr2 /var/www/html/centos/6/os/x86_64/
mount: /var/www/html/centos/6/os/x86_64: WARNING: device write-protected, mounted read-only.

5.准备kickstart文件

#准备kickstart文件并放在http服务器上
#创建kickstart相关文件夹
[root@centos8 ~]# mkdir /var/www/html/ks/
#编辑6对应的kickstart文件
[root@centos8 ~]# cat /var/www/html/ks/centos6.cfg
install
text
reboot
url --url=http://10.0.0.8/centos/6/os/x86_64/
lang en_US.UTF-8
keyboard us
network --onboot yes --device eth0 --bootproto dhcp --noipv6
rootpw --iscrypted $6$j9YhzDUnQVnxaAk8$qv7rkMcPAEbV5yvwsP666DXWYadd3jYjkA9fpxAo9qYotjGGBUclCGoP1TRvgHBpqgc5n0RypMsPTQnVDcpO01
firewall --disabled
authconfig --enableshadow --passalgo=sha512
selinux --disabled
timezone Asia/Shanghai
bootloader --location=mbr --driveorder=sda --append="crashkernel=auto rhgb quiet"
zerombr
clearpart --all --initlabel
part /boot --fstype=ext4 --size=1024
part / --fstype=ext4 --size=50000
part /data --fstype=ext4 --size=30000
part swap --size=2048
%packages
@core
@server-policy
@workstation-policy
autofs
vim-enhanced
%end
%post
useradd wang
echo magedu | passwd --stdin wang &> /dev/null
mkdir /etc/yum.repos.d/bak
mv /etc/yum.repos.d/* /etc/yum.repos.d/bak
cat > /etc/yum.repos.d/base.repo <<EOF
[base]
name=base
baseurl=file:///misc/cd
gpgcheck=0
EOF
%end

6.准备PXE启动相关文件

#准备6,7,8的各自内核文件,内核文件在光盘中
[root@centos8 ~]# mkdir /var/lib/tftpboot/centos{6,7,8} #创建相关文件夹
#将内核文件及启动文件拷贝至对应文件夹
[root@centos8 ~]# cp /var/www/html/centos/6/os/x86_64/isolinux/{vmlinuz,initrd.img} /var/lib/tftpboot/centos6/
[root@centos8 ~]# cp /var/www/html/centos/7/os/x86_64/isolinux/{vmlinuz,initrd.img} /var/lib/tftpboot/centos7/
[root@centos8 ~]# cp /var/www/html/centos/8/os/x86_64/isolinux/{vmlinuz,initrd.img} /var/lib/tftpboot/centos8/
#拷贝bootloader启动引导文件,这些文件由syslinux-nonlinux包提供,第一步已经安装
[root@centos8 ~]# cp /usr/share/syslinux/{pxelinux.0,menu.c32} /var/lib/tftpboot/
#以下3个文件centos8需要安装,6,7不需要安装
[root@centos8 ~]# cp /var/www/html/centos/8/os/x86_64/isolinux/{ldlinux.c32,libcom32.c32,libutil.c32} /var/lib/tftpboot/
#创建菜单文件
[root@centos8 ~]# mkdir /var/lib/tftpboot/pxelinux.cfg/
#将8的菜单文件复制到该目录
[root@centos8 ~]# cp /var/www/html/centos/8/os/x86_64/isolinux/isolinux.cfg /var/lib/tftpboot/pxelinux.cfg/default

7.准备启动菜单文件

#编辑菜单文件
[root@centos8 ~]# cat /var/lib/tftpboot/pxelinux.cfg/default
default menu.c32
timeout 600

menu title CentOS Linux Install

label linux7
menu label AUTO Install CentOS Linux ^7
kernel centos7/vmlinuz
append initrd=centos7/initrd.img ks=http://10.0.0.8/ks/centos7.cfg

label linux6
menu label AUTO Install CentOS Linux ^6
kernel centos6/vmlinuz
append initrd=centos6/initrd.img ks=http://10.0.0.8/ks/centos6.cfg

label manual
menu label ^Manual Install CentOS Linux 8.0
kernel centos8/vmlinuz
append initrd=centos8/initrd.img
inst.repo=http://10.0.0.8/centos/8/os/x86_64

label rescue
menu label ^Rescue a CentOS Linux system 8
kernel centos8/vmlinuz
append initrd=centos8/initrd.img
inst.repo=http://10.0.0.8/centos/8/os/x86_64/ rescue

label local
menu default
menu label Boot from ^local drive
localboot 0xffff

8.在客户端测试基于PXE自动安装

#准备一台新主机,设置网卡引导,可看到启动菜单,实现自动安装
